What are winters like in Hampton Virginia?
In Hampton, the summers are warm and muggy, the winters are very cold and windy, and it is wet and partly cloudy year round. Over the course of the year, the temperature typically varies from 33°F to 87°F and is rarely below 22°F or above 94°F.

Is Hampton VA Safe?
Hampton is the only midsize Virginia city to be named one of the 100 safest in America. Midsize cities are those with populations between 100,000 and 300,000.

What is Hampton VA famous for?
The city has a vibrant arts community, distinctive festivals, signature events and cultural attractions that include the Fort Monroe National Monument, Virginia Air and Space Center, Hampton History Museum, Hampton Coliseum, The American Theatre, harbor tours, cruises and more!

Does Hampton Virginia get hurricanes?
Coastal Virginia is the state’s area most prone to hurricanes and tropical storms. Hurricanes and tropical storms impact Hampton Roads with their strong winds, rains, and storm surges.

What part of Virginia gets the most snow?
That is, unless you happen to be a resident of an area known as Wise. This small town located in southwestern Virginia experiences an average annual snowfall of over four feet. Wise is famous for its snowy self, and known as the town that gets the most snow in Virginia.
